Macron's Initiative to Strengthen Ukraine's Security
French President Emmanuel Macron is advocating for European nations to take greater responsibility in providing security guarantees for Ukraine. During a summit that includes Ukrainian President Vladimir Zelensky and representatives from 29 nations, the focus is on formulating a solid plan for Ukraine's security amid ongoing conflict. Macron has announced a €2 billion military aid package, which aims to bolster Ukraine's defenses with missiles and armored vehicles. The discussions are sparked by the urgency of the situation, especially in light of U.S. policy changes with President Trump's return to the White House, highlighting the need for a united European front.
Coalition of the Willing: Europe's Response to Ukraine
The 'Coalition of the Willing' represents a concerted effort by European leaders to develop a unified stance on the ongoing conflict in Ukraine. This meeting follows a previous summit in London and comes at a time when questions around NATO spending and military presence in Ukraine are hotly debated. Key figures like Macron and UK Prime Minister Keir Starmer are urging concrete steps towards both military and diplomatic solutions, gauging the feasibility of ground troops while managing fears of escalating the conflict with Russia. The coalition’s effectiveness will likely depend on the clarity and strength of their collective proposals.

The Role of European Defense Industries Amid Supply Chain Pressures
French defense contractors are facing significant challenges in meeting increased demand as European nations ramp up military spending. The reliance on over 4,000 small and medium-sized subcontractors raises concerns about potential bottlenecks in production capabilities, particularly as these businesses struggle with pandemic-related debt. Articles in French media highlight the urgent need for government intervention to support these firms through improved access to credit and funding. If these supply chain issues are not addressed, they may hinder the ability of larger defense companies to fulfill their commitments to bolster Ukraine and European security.
